The Distribution Reference field isn't going to be tied to anything because it's a user-entry field - something that the user would type in. As you have discovered, the Audit Trail code is equal to the Batch ID of the subsidiary transaction. Also something to keep in mind is that the distribution detail you're drilling down to in the subsidiary module is merely the entry that was suggested to the general ledger. This isn't necessarily the numbers that were used. So, I'm wondering, why isn't getting back to the document enough. The suggested debits and credits really shouldn't be relied upon.
